Westmeath has 4 coworking spaces and remote working hubs, covering the county's two main centres — Athlone and Mullingar — plus a motorway-junction hub at Kinnegad and a community space at Milltown Rathconrath. For a midlands county sitting at the crossroads of the M4, M6 and the Dublin–Galway rail line, it is one of the most commutable hub networks in the country.
Westmeath's economy is driven by Athlone's role as the commercial capital of the midlands (TUS Midlands, Ericsson, Azon Recycling, a substantial retail and services sector) and Mullingar's public-sector, financial-services and manufacturing base. The ACT Co-Working Hub in Athlone sits in the ACT Business Development Centre on Parnell Square and supports startups and independent professionals. The E-Working Centre in Mullingar operates out of the County Buildings complex and serves the town's remote workforce. The Kinnegad Plaza is a motorway-service-area work hub at the M4/M6 junction — useful for people on the road between Dublin and the west. Milltown Rathconrath Community Broadband Hub extends coverage to the rural south-west of the county.
Day rates are broadly in the €15–€25 range, with fibre broadband across the network, meeting rooms bookable by the hour, free parking and on-site staff at the main urban hubs. ACT Co-Working in Athlone offers private offices, meeting rooms and event space; the E-Working Centre in Mullingar has a traditional town-centre setup. The Kinnegad Plaza is specifically designed for in-transit work sessions. Milltown Rathconrath leans community, with affordable access for local residents.
Remote employees living in Athlone or Mullingar who want out of the home office finally have two credible options. Freelancers and small teams can take meeting rooms or private offices at ACT Co-Working. Consultants and sales reps on the Dublin–Galway run can use Kinnegad as a mid-journey work stop.
